Cannabis use in adolescence represents a critical public health challenge, given that this stage constitutes a window of vulnerability for the development of the central nervous system. In this study, the effect of oromucosal exposure to THC-enriched Cannabis sativa oil administered during adolescence was evaluated in adult rats. The objective was to evaluate how this intervention alters the behavioral response to frustration, using the Successive Negative Contrast (SNC) paradigm. First, the administration method and dosage schedule were validated using a battery of standardized behavioral tests. It was found that: (1) adult rats treated with cannabis moved significantly more than those treated with vehicle in the Open Field test; (2) they spent less time interacting with the novel object in the Novel Object Recognition test; and (3) they spent less time in the dark in the Dark/Light Room test. Finally, in the CNS test, they exhibited a lower frustration response (measured as less suppression of the instrumental response). These results demonstrated that this treatment promotes cognitive memory deficits, as measured by the NOR, as well as differences in the Open Field test, the Dark/Light Room test, and the CNS test. Thus, it can be established as a novel model for studying the effects of cannabis use in adolescence on frustration behavior.
